On this episode of Voices of a Killer, we talk to Kansas-born Marcus Spielman, a man convicted of murdering his long-time friend, Ronnie Engel. At just 25 years old, Marcus, who was born into a stable, middle-class family, now finds himself behind the bars of a prison cell. We’ll hear about the misguided choices Marcus made, the circumstances that led him to raise his gun at Ronnie, and the lessons he’s learned after the incident. This interview is a stark warning about the power of addiction to wreck a promising young life.
